Sec. 412.20  Hospital services subject to the prospective payment systems.


    (a) Except for services described in paragraphs (b), (c), and (d) of 
this section, all covered inpatient hospital services furnished to 
beneficiaries during subject cost reporting periods are paid under the 
prospective payment systems specified in Sec. 412.1(a)(1).
    (b) Effective for cost reporting periods beginning on or after 
January 1, 2002, covered inpatient hospital services furnished to 
Medicare beneficiaries by a rehabilitation hospital or rehabilitation 
unit that meet the conditions of Sec. 412.604 are paid under the 
prospective payment system described in subpart P of this part.
    (c) Effective for cost reporting periods beginning on or after 
October 1, 2002, covered inpatient hospital services furnished to 
Medicare beneficiaries by a long-term care hospital that meets the 
conditions for payment of Secs. 412.505 through 412.511 are paid under 
the prospective payment system described in subpart O of this part.
    (d) Inpatient hospital services will not be paid under the 
prospective payment systems specified in Sec. 412.1(a)(1) under any of 
the following circumstances:
    (1) The services are furnished by a hospital (or hospital unit) 
explicitly excluded from the prospective payment systems under 
Secs. 412.23, 412.25, 412.27, and 412.29.
    (2) The services are emergency services furnished by a 
nonparticipating hospital in accordance with Sec. 424.103 of this 
chapter.
    (3) The services are paid for by an HMO or competitive medical plan 
(CMP) that elects not to have CMS make payments directly to a hospital

[[Page 376]]

for inpatient hospital services furnished to the HMO's or CMP's Medicare 
enrollees, as provided in Sec. 417.240(d) and Sec. 417.586 of this 
chapter.
